清华大学食堂数据分析echarts graph配置项内容和展示

各食堂关系

配置项如下
      option = {
    backgroundColor: new echarts.graphic.RadialGradient(0.3, 0.3, 0.8, [{
        offset: 0,
        color: '#f7f8fa'
    }, {
        offset: 1,
        color: '#cdd0d5'
    }]),
       title:{
        text: "清华大学食堂数据分析",
        subtext: "各食堂关系",
        top: "top",
        left: "center"
    },
      tooltip: {},
      legend: [{
          formatter: function (name) {
        return echarts.format.truncateText(name, 40, '14px Microsoft Yahei', '…');
    },
    tooltip: {
        show: true
    },
          selectedMode: 'false',
          bottom: 20,
          data: ['清芬园', '紫荆园', '桃李园', '听涛园', '观畴园', '芝兰园', '玉漱园', '照澜园', '寓园', '荷园']
      }],
      toolbox: {
        show : true,
        feature : {
            dataView : {show: true, readOnly: true},
            restore : {show: true},
            saveAsImage : {show: true}
        }
    },
      animationDuration: 3000,
      animationEasingUpdate: 'quinticInOut',
      series: [{
          name: '清华大学食堂',
          type: 'graph',
          layout: 'force',

          force: {
              repulsion: 50
          },
          data: [{
              "name": "清华大学食堂",
              // "x": 0,
              // y: 0,
              "symbolSize": 20,
              "draggable": "true",
              "value": 27

          }, {
              "name": "清芬园",
              "value": 3,
              "symbolSize": 9,
              "category": "清芬园",
              "draggable": "true"
          }, {
              "name": "清芬园一层",
              "symbolSize": 3,
              "category": "清芬园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"清芬园二层",
              "symbolSize": 3,
              "category": "清芬园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"清芬园三层",
              "symbolSize": 3,
              "category": "清芬园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"紫荆园",
              "value": 6,
              "symbolSize": 18,
              "category": "紫荆园",
              "draggable": "true"
          }, {
              "name": "紫荆园一层",
              "symbolSize": 3,
              "category": "紫荆园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"紫荆园二层",
              "symbolSize": 3,
              "category": "紫荆园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"紫荆园三层",
              "symbolSize": 3,
              "category": "紫荆园",
              "draggable": "true",
              "value": 1
          },{
              "name": "紫荆园四层",
              "symbolSize": 3,
              "category": "紫荆园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"桃李园",
              "value": 5,
              "symbolSize": 15,
              "category": "桃李园",
              "draggable": "true"
          }, {
              "name": "桃李园一层",
              "symbolSize": 3,
              "category": "桃李园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"桃李园二层",
              "symbolSize": 3,
              "category": "桃李园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"桃李园三层",
              "symbolSize": 3,
              "category": "桃李园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"桃李园四层",
              "symbolSize": 3,
              "category": "桃李园",
              "draggable": "true",
              "value": 1
          },{
              "name": "听涛园",
              "value": 6,
              "symbolSize": 18,
              "category": "听涛园",
              "draggable": "true"
          }, {
              "name": "听涛园一层",
              "symbolSize": 3,
              "category": "听涛园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"听涛园二层",
              "symbolSize": 3,
              "category": "听涛园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"观畴园",
              "value": 8,
              "symbolSize": 24,
              "category": "观畴园",
              "draggable": "true"
          }, {
              "name": "观畴园一层",
              "symbolSize": 3,
              "category": "观畴园",
              "draggable": "true",
              "value": 1
          },{
              "name": "观畴园二层",
              "symbolSize": 3,
              "category": "观畴园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"观畴园三层",
              "symbolSize": 3,
              "category": "观畴园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"芝兰园",
              "value": 5,
              "symbolSize": 15,
              "category": "芝兰园",
              "draggable": "true"
          }, {
              "name": "芝兰园一层",
              "symbolSize": 3,
              "category": "芝兰园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"芝兰园二层",
              "symbolSize": 3,
              "category": "芝兰园",
              "draggable": "true",
              "value": 1
          },{
              "name": "玉漱园",
              "value": 6,
              "symbolSize": 18,
              "category": "玉漱园",
              "draggable": "true"
          },{
              "name": "玉漱园一层",
              "symbolSize": 3,
              "category": "玉漱园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"玉漱园二层",
              "symbolSize": 3,
              "category": "玉漱园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"照澜园",
              "value": 10,
              "symbolSize": 30,
              "category": "照澜园",
              "draggable": "true"
          }, {
              "name": "照澜园一层",
              "symbolSize": 3,
              "category": "照澜园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"照澜园二层",
              "symbolSize": 3,
              "category": "照澜园",
              "draggable": "true",
              "value": 1
          },{
              "name": "寓园",
              "value": 6,
              "symbolSize": 18,
              "category": "寓园",
              "draggable": "true"
          }, {
              "name": "寓园一层",
              "symbolSize": 3,
              "category": "寓园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"寓园二层",
              "symbolSize": 3,
              "category": "寓园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"荷园",
              "value": 6,
              "symbolSize": 18,
              "category": "荷园",
              "draggable": "true"
          }, {
              "name": "荷园一层",
              "symbolSize": 3,
              "category": "荷园",
              "draggable": "true",
              "value": 1
          }, {
              "name": "荷园二层",
              "symbolSize": 3,
              "category": "荷园",
              "draggable": "true",
              "value": 1
          }],
          links: [{
              "source": "清华大学食堂",
              "target": "清芬园"
          }, {
              "source": "清芬园",
              "target": "清芬园一层"
          }, {
              "source": "清芬园",
              "target": "清芬园二层"
          }, {
              "source": "清芬园",
              "target": "清芬园三层"
          }, {
              "source": "清华大学食堂",
              "target": "紫荆园"
          }, {
              "source": "紫荆园",
              "target": "紫荆园一层"
          }, {
              "source": "紫荆园",
              "target": "紫荆园二层"
          }, {
              "source": "紫荆园",
              "target": "紫荆园三层"
          }, {
              "source": "紫荆园",
              "target": "紫荆园四层"
          }, {
              "source": "清华大学食堂",
              "target": "桃李园"
          }, {
              "source": "桃李园",
              "target": "桃李园一层"
          }, {
              "source": "桃李园",
              "target": "桃李园二层"
          }, {
              "source": "桃李园",
              "target": "桃李园三层"
          }, {
              "source": "桃李园",
              "target": "桃李园四层"
          }, {
              "source": "清华大学食堂",
              "target": "听涛园"
          }, {
              "source": "听涛园",
              "target": "听涛园一层"
          }, {
              "source": "听涛园",
              "target": "听涛园二层"
          }, {
              "source": "清华大学食堂",
              "target": "观畴园"
          }, {
              "source": "观畴园",
              "target": "观畴园一层"
          }, {
              "source": "观畴园",
              "target": "观畴园二层"
          }, {
              "source": "观畴园",
              "target": "观畴园三层"
          }, {
              "source": "清华大学食堂",
              "target": "芝兰园"
          }, {
              "source": "芝兰园",
              "target": "芝兰园一层"
          }, {
              "source": "芝兰园",
              "target": "芝兰园二层"
          },  {
              "source": "清华大学食堂",
              "target": "玉漱园"
          }, {
              "source": "玉漱园",
              "target": "玉漱园一层"
          }, {
              "source": "玉漱园",
              "target": "玉漱园二层"
          }, {
              "source": "清华大学食堂",
              "target": "照澜园"
          }, {
              "source": "照澜园",
              "target": "照澜园一层"
          }, {
              "source": "照澜园",
              "target": "照澜园二层"
          },{
              "source": "清华大学食堂",
              "target": "寓园"
          }, {
              "source": "寓园",
              "target": "寓园一层"
          }, {
              "source": "寓园",
              "target": "寓园二层"
          },{
              "source": "清华大学食堂",
              "target": "荷园"
          }, {
              "source": "荷园",
              "target": "荷园一层"
          }, {
              "source": "荷园",
              "target": "荷园二层"
          }],
          categories: [{
              'name': '清芬园'
          }, {
              'name': '紫荆园'
          }, {
              'name': '桃李园'
          }, {
              'name': '听涛园'
          }, {
              'name': '观畴园'
          }, {
              'name': '芝兰园'
          }, {
              'name': '玉漱园'
          }, {
              'name': '照澜园'
          }, {
              'name': '寓园'
          }, {
              'name': '荷园'
          }],
          focusNodeAdjacency: true,
          roam: true,
          label: {
              normal: {

                  show: true,
                  position: 'top',

              }
          },
          lineStyle: {
              normal: {
                  color: 'source',
                  curveness: 0,
                  type: "solid"
              }
          }
      }]
  };
    
截图如下